After an aliquot of sample is injected into your HPLC column, the solvent composition could be held constant (isocratic elution) or even the organic element may very well be improved (gradient elution) depending on the wanted result of the separation.

The velocity of each and every element relies on its chemical nature, on the character of the stationary stage (column) and to the composition of your cellular period. Enough time at which a certain analyte elutes (emerges with the column) is known as its retention time. The retention time measured less than individual circumstances is really an determining characteristic of a provided analyte.
